Changing the tunable values using SMIT

Several VxVM parameters can be tuned using the System Management Interface Tool (SMIT). Some VxVM parameters can be tuned only using the vxtune command.

To change the values of the tunables

  1. Select Systems Storage Management (Physical & Logical Storage) > VERITAS Volume Manager > Change / Show VxVM Tunables
  2. Press the down arrow key until the particular tunable parameter displays.
  3. Change the value of the tunables as follows:
    • Tunables with values in bytes.

      Position your cursor in the entry field, enter a new value (in bytes), and then press Return to initiate the change.

    • Tunables with options, such as Transport used for VVR and Replication over NAT based Firewall.

      Position your cursor in the entry field. Press the Tab key until the desired value appears.

  4. Reboot the system for the changes to take effect.
